I am a game designer & graduate from the Georgia Institute of Technology. My other concentrations are in UX, practical applications of semi-autonomous agents, & software engineering.

All of these deal with systems of interaction between more-or-less independent components. While the internal logic of the actors & organization differs, these interconnected webs are directly comparable.

I’ve always had a an interest in the way a games’ mechanics create the themes, ‘message’, or ‘meaning’ of a game. Genres such as 4X “map games”, or old-school strategy-tactics hybrids in the vein of X-COM, may seem to have little thematic content; yet they train players into rigorous, unemotional consideration of their webs of possibilities. The medium is still the message.

Senior Capstone: Game Studio

One of the final requirements of any degree awarded by the Georgia Institute of Technology is the Senior Capstone, a semester-long studio which produces a working prototype of a video game, or other piece of interactive media. This prototype is ideally a “vertical slice” of gameplay, effectively a miniature version of the entire game. My team created Lost Time, a laid-back interactive narrative; to which I contributed the Dialogue Front-End & implemented the UI.
